TECH. SCHOOL SPORTS

TWO NEW MILE RECORDS Preliminary events, in connection with the Greymouth Technical School annual sports (to be held on the Recreation Ground, on Wednesday) were held today. Results: — Mile Senior Championship—H. Mathieson (Tainui) 1, V. Hazeldine (Taiaroa) 2, R. Morris (Tainui) 3. Time: 'smin. 10 4-5 sec. (a record). Previous record: 5 min. 15 3-5 sec. Mile Junior Championship—R. Leitch (Takitimu), 1, J. Airey (Tainui) 2, R. Watson (Takitimu) 3. Time: 5 min. 23 3-5 sec. (a record). Previous record: 5 min. 38 4-5 sec. Mile Open Handicap—A. Campbell (200 yds.) (Arawa) 1; E. Moseley (220 yds.), (Arawa) 2; W. Faulkner (180 yds.), (Takitimu) 3. Time: 4 min. 50 4-5 sec. Very close finish.
